路由器Padavan固件无法从WAN口访问SMB服务“无法访问,你可能没有权限访问网络资源”
首先,需要关闭防火墙或者添加相应的防火墙规则
然后,SSH登录路由器,编辑/etc/storage/script0_script.sh这个shell脚本
在文件内添加以下内容
sed -i ‘/interfaces = br0/s/interfaces/#interfaces/g’ /etc/smb.conf killall -9 smbd killall -9 nmbd /sbin/smbd -D -s /etc/smb.conf /sbin/nmbd -D -s /etc/smb.conf
然后保存,重启
Padavan路由器系统如何放开wan口的samba访问
一. 网络拓扑和配置概述
1.主路由器为普通路由器,作为运营商拨号接入,LAN IP: 192.168.1.1
2.Padavan 路由器为二级路由器.
产品型号:RT-N14U-GPIO-1-youku1-128M
固件版本:3.4.3.9-099_10-12
CPU:7620A
RAM:128M DDR2
FLASH:16M
二级路由器的WAN口接到主路由器的一个LAN口。
二级路由器的WAN IP设置为静态IP,为192.168.1.2。
二级路由器的LAN IP :192.168.123.1
二级路由器插入tf卡和U盘,并开启了samba服务。
默认只有192.168.123.x网段才能访问samba共享文件夹,现在的目标是
连接主路由器的192.168.1.x网段也能访问samba共享文件夹,即放开wan口的samba访问。
Padavan固件从WAN口访问SMB服务
1、打开路由器管理页面http://192.168.123.1/,用户名admin,密码admin
进入 高级设置-自定义设置 - 脚本
点开“在防火墙规则 (Emong’s Qos) 启动后执行: “,
在最下面一行logger -t “【防火墙规则】” “脚本完成” 这一行前面加入如下脚本
#放行SAMBA端口 logger -t "【SAMBA服务器】" "允许SAMBA访问" iptables -I INPUT 1 -p udp -m multiport --dport 137,138 -j ACCEPT iptables -I INPUT 1 -p tcp -m state --state NEW -m multiport --dport 139,445 -j ACCEPT #logger -t "【防火墙规则】" "脚本完成" #(原本有的一行,不用加入)
2、进入 高级设置-自定义设置 - 脚本
点开“自定义脚本0(功能配置): “,找到最下面“#↑↑↑功能详细设置↑↑↑ “, 在这一行前面加入如下脚本
#开启wan口eth2.2端口的samba共享 sed -i 's/interfaces =.*/interfaces = eth2.2 br0/' /etc/smb.conf /bin/kill -9 `pidof smbd` smbd -D -s /etc/smb.conf #↑↑↑功能详细设置↑↑↑ #(原本有的一行,不用加入)
其中,eth2.2 是wan口地址192.168.1.2的接口的名称。
上面的两个地方改好后,点击”应用本页面设置”,然后,点击页面右上方的重启按钮,重启后,192.168.1.x网段也能访问这个samba共享文件夹。
最终效果
\\192.168.1.2 \\192.168.123.1
windows资源管理器打开上面这两个地址之一,都能进入samba共享
Padavan华硕固件SMB 服务器“无法访问,你可能没有权限访问网络资源”
H大老毛子Padavan华硕固件SMB 服务器 (Windows网络邻居)开启帐号允许后,访问时输入帐号密码后提示“无法访问,你可能没有权限访问网络资源”是怎么回事?
还有允许外网访问 FTP 服务器这个想改端口号,但是试了几个都不能访问,难道只能设为21端口吗?
H大老毛子Padavan华硕固件开启SMB 服务器提示“无法访问,你可能没有权限访问网络资源”一般是因为路由器没有选择全部允许访问导致的,samba改成全部允许就可以了。
还有允许外网访问 FTP 服务器这个想改端口号,但是试了几个都不能访问,难道只能设为21端口吗?
如下图修改外网访问FTP端口到防火墙“外网访问 FTP 服务器端口:”这里修改为对应的端口即可。
点击链接加入群聊三群:751529538
点击链接加入群聊二群:376877156
点击链接加入群聊【路由器交流群:622891808已满】
本站附件分享,如果附件失效,可以去找找看
饿了么红包